Transaction 5697694c81f4aad94299d4e0807975ff333abedbfc70c8f0da1299a6cadea945
3 Input
2 Outputs
- 5697694c81f4aad94299d4e0807975ff333abedbfc70c8f0da1299a6cadea945:0
- 5697694c81f4aad94299d4e0807975ff333abedbfc70c8f0da1299a6cadea945:1
value 198341776
address 1EzGV3DzS5RE5AJu1ZdBrzJxAiNoGy9xao
value 350000000
address 1LPMJ2xWcA6hSYa2xhvXneUkMsCChBqLKm